Activity 1
Technical Warm-Up
4v2 Possession & Penetration
Setup: TRAINING AREA = 12W x 12L. Place (1) play on the outside of the space, on each side of the square. Position (2) defenders inside the space. The defenders may not leave the space, but can block, or intercept passes.
Goal: Four outside players (one on each side of the 12-yard square) keep the ball away from the two defenders trapped inside. The attackers score by stringing consecutive passes, holding possession for a set time, and splitting passes between the two defenders. The defenders score by deflecting or intercepting passes, or by winning the ball and dribbling out of the square under control.
Coaching Points
- Defensive pressure on the ball (speed, body stance, angle, distance)
- Approach quickly to the ball - long strides
- Slow down as you approach the ball - short, choppy strides
- Bend knees, weight on toes when pressuring the ball
- Move feet, hips, and head as the offensive player moves the ball
Activity 2
Small-Sided Activity
3v3 to One Goal
Setup: TRAINING AREA = 20W x 30L. Place (2) tall cones on each end-line 5 yards apart making (1) goal on each endline. Red v White. Score by passing the ball on the ground through the goal. Variations: Play for set period of time; Play to a specific number (#) of goals; Double points if goal comes after a steal; -Double points if a goal comes after an interception
Goal: Two teams of three attack the 5-yard cone goal on their opponent's end line and defend their own. A goal counts only when the ball is passed along the ground through the goal (not in the air). Goals are worth double if they come right after winning the ball by a steal or an interception, which rewards fast transition to attack.
Coaching Points
- Defensive pressure on the ball (speed, body stance, angle, distance)
- Who: The 2nd defender, or player who is closest to their teammate defending the ball
- Why: The 2nd defender can help to cover any mistakes made by the 1st defender
Activity 3
Expanded Small-Sided Activity
5v5 to One Goal
Setup: TRAINING AREA = 30W x 40L. Place (1) goal on each end-line for teams to attack.
Goal: Two teams of five play to a full goal on each end line, scoring by putting the ball into the goal. Goals count double when they come right after a steal or an interception, so winning the ball and attacking quickly is rewarded. Play for time or to a set number of goals.
Coaching Points
- Defensive pressure on the ball (speed, body stance, angle, distance)
- Who: The 2nd defender, or player who is closest to their teammate defending the ball
- Why: The 2nd defender can help to cover any mistakes made by the 1st defender
Activity 4
Game
Goal: Apply what you practiced today in a real game.
Play a scrimmage with the biggest teams possible, or play small-sided if you have fewer players or less space. Reinforce all points above.
